feat: unify block, function, and method body parsing to support single-expression implicit returns
Refactor `finishBlock` in `wren_compiler.c` to detect single-expression bodies (no newline after `{`) and leave a value on the stack, enabling implicit returns for methods and functions. Add `finishBody` wrapper to handle constructor flag. Update all benchmark and test `.wren` files to remove explicit `return` keywords from getters and single-expression methods, relying on the new implicit return behavior. Remove old `return_null_if_brace.wren` test, add `newline_body.wren`, `newline_in_expression_block.wren`, and `no_newline_before_close.wren` tests for edge cases.
